Standing tall as a symbol of human potential, Michelangelo's magnificent statue of David is a epitome to the artist's unparalleled skill. Carved from a single block of stone, this colossal work of art stands at over 17 feet tall, its every detail carefully rendered.

From the strong stance to the detailed features on David's face, Michelangelo has captured the essence of both physical and emotional strength. The statue stands as a symbol of Florence's cultural height, attracting millions of admirers each year to marvel its sheer grandeur.

The statue's impact extends beyond the realm of art, becoming a symbol of democracy. Its position in Florence's Piazza della Signoria serves as a constant reminder of the city's history and its role in shaping Western culture.

A Sculpting Triumph: The Illustration of David

Michelangelo's colossal work of art, David, stands as a monumental testament to the power of human form and artistic genius. The physical precision with which Michelangelo has captured the young David's physique is breathtaking. Every muscle, every tendon, is rendered with unerring detail, creating a sense of liveliness that seems to throb within the marble itself. More than just a tribute to physical beauty, David embodies strength, qualities that were deeply revered in Renaissance Florence.

The figure of David, poised on the cusp of battle against Goliath, is one of {confidentassurance. His minute smile suggests a latent confidence, hinting at the success that awaits him. The contrapposto, where the weight of David's body is shifted to one leg, creates a sense of energy and implies the impending action.
